Matthews International Corporation (MATW) shares declined 2.47% to close at $26.45, moving closer to its established support near $25.13. The stock now faces resistance at $27.77, a level that could determine near-term direction. The drop occurred amid broader market pressure, with MATW underperforming its industrial peers.
